project x 6.0 or 6.5

I am buying new iron (titleist ap2). My 6 iron swing speed is 95mph and 188y (carry).  My hdcp is 8. Now i play TM r7 - t-step 90g stiff shaft. It's toooo soft for me. So should i buy 6.0 or 6.5 project x. I played with DG S300 and s400 but i don't like it (heavy).

If you feel the DGs are heavy you are gonna think the same with project X

DG S300 are 130g or 132 with Sensicore. PX 6.0/6.5 are 125g so will feel a bit lighter. IMO, I would go for PX 6.0 and try them, if they feel too soft then hard step them once. They are stiff to flex anyway. PX 6.5 are for gorillas mostly and will limit you on feel shots. I tried them once and got rid quick. If you are going with PX flighted then they are softer than std PX and not as good IMO.

I have just swopped from dg400's to project x 6.5, i love them they feel much lighter than the 400's and my iron play has never been so accurate.
